WebMegalographa biloba is a medium-sized (FW length 16 - 18 mm) brown moth that has been collected at widely disparate localities throughout the Northwest during most of the year. … Stephens' gem or the bilobed looper (Megalographa biloba) is a moth of the family Noctuidae. It is widely distributed from the southern parts of the United States, south through Central America and South America to Argentina. As a seasonal migrant it occurs even farther north into the northern parts of the United States and southern Canada. http://mothphotographersgroup.msstate.edu/species.php?hodges=8907 WebBilobed Looper Moth. Megalographa biloba. Tweet; Description: This species was formerly Autographa biloba, but placed in its own genus by Lafontaine and Poole in 1991.
